Helios Underwriting moves to acquire Fyshe at discounted rate

15th August 2018 - Author: Staff Writer

Helios Underwriting plc has announced a conditional agreement to acquire Fyshe Underwriting, a limited liability member of Lloyd’s of London, for a cash consideration of £68,630.

mergers and acquisitionsThe consideration represents a 38% discount of the £111,526 independent valuation placed on Fyshe by Humphrey’s.

Helios, who had previously announced a strategy to increase underwriting capacity through acquisition, is expected to leverage Fyshe’s broadly matching portfolio to build its participation on the Lloyd’s syndicates.

As of 2018 the underwriting capacity of Fyshe is £500,150 – compared to Helios’ £41 million, rated prior to the acquisition.

In addition to the Fyshe transaction, Helios is continuing to pursue further Lloyd’s transactions in line with its strategy.
